Vendor note: Graulex Data Services — ProfileHive sharding

Graulex manages the physical shard placement for the ProfileHive user-profile store under contract through Q3. If a shard rebalance stalls or replication lag exceeds the agreed threshold, Graulex owns remediation within two hours per the SLA. Do not attempt manual shard moves yourself; this voids their incident commitment. Log the incident in our tracker first, then escalate to their operations desk.

escalation mailbox, bafog-fafog: ulador@paliqlabs.internal

## Deployment

PointsKeeper, the loyalty-points ledger, deploys via the standard Helmway pipeline. Deploys are blue-green; the ledger writer must drain before the new replica takes writes, or balances can double-post. On-call should verify the drain gauge hits zero before promoting. Rollbacks are safe within one schema version. The service reads its settings from the mounted config, which in production contains the following.

config for taguf-tafof:
zorath:
  log_level: error
  metrics_host: metrics.zorath.zemvarlabs.internal
  pin: 5550
  pool_size: 32

CI troubleshooting — Brightgate consent banner rollout. The pipeline failed at the policy-scan stage because the new banner bundle introduced an inline script that violated our strict-CSP check. We have refactored the script into a hashed external file and re-run the full scan; no further violations were detected. For audit purposes, the passing pipeline run can be verified against the token recorded below.

trace token, fafog-kageg: htk4_98e6